A dog groomer, also called a pet groomer or an animal care worker, keeps dogs clean and helps maintain their hygiene. Dog groomers help dogs stay healthy by reporting swelling, cuts, parasites like fleas or ticks, or any other health problems they come across to owners. They also keep dogs from bringing bad smells, bugs, dirt or bacteria into homes.
